共用方式為


IDirectDraw7::GetSurfaceFromDC 方法 (ddraw.h)

根據介面的 GDI 裝置內容句柄,擷取介面的 IDirectDrawSurface7 介面。

語法

HRESULT GetSurfaceFromDC(
  [in]  HDC                  unnamedParam1,
  [out] LPDIRECTDRAWSURFACE7 *unnamedParam2
);

參數

[in] unnamedParam1

顯示裝置內容的句柄。

[out] unnamedParam2

如果呼叫成功,要填入介面 IDirectDrawSurface7 介面指標的變數位址。

傳回值

如果方法成功,傳回值會DD_OK。

如果失敗,方法可以傳回下列其中一個錯誤值:

  • DDERR_GENERIC
  • DDERR_INVALIDPARAMS
  • DDERR_OUTOFMEMORY
  • DDERR_NOTFOUND

備註

這個方法只會針對識別已經與 DirectDraw 對象相關聯的表面的裝置內容句柄成功。

規格需求

需求
目標平台 Windows
標頭 ddraw.h
程式庫 Ddraw.lib
Dll Ddraw.dll

另請參閱

IDirectDraw7